Managing Data Engineer (Palantir Foundry) – London – Salary Up To £100,000 per annum

Are you a strategic, hands-on engineering leader ready to shape impactful AI solutions? A Palantir expert with a passion for leading teams and delivering value? Then Morela has the opportunity for you.

Morela are proud to be partnering with one of the UK’s top Palantir specialists, who are scaling fast and seeking a Managing Data Engineer to lead delivery teams, oversee key engagements, and drive technical excellence across complex data projects. This role is ideal for someone who combines deep technical expertise with leadership experience and a passion for mentoring high-performing teams.

You’ll be joining a forward-thinking consultancy known for its work at the intersection of advanced technology, AI, and real-world impact. Operating across public and private sectors, their services span strategic advisory, digital transformation, and full-lifecycle engineering. As a Managing Data Engineer, you’ll play a pivotal role in setting technical direction, managing client relationships, and ensuring solutions deliver lasting value.

Core Responsibilities

Technical Leadership: Set the technical direction for projects, ensuring high standards in architecture, scalability, and performance across Palantir Foundry implementations.
Team Management: Lead and mentor multidisciplinary teams, providing both strategic guidance and day-to-day support to engineers, analysts, and consultants.
Client Engagement: Build and manage strong client relationships, acting as a trusted advisor and translating business needs into robust technical solutions.
Delivery Oversight: Own project delivery from end to end scoping, resource planning, risk management, and ensuring on-time, high quality outcomes.
Solution Governance: Review designs and implementations to ensure they meet compliance, security, and engineering best practices.
Continuous Improvement: Contribute to internal capability building improving frameworks, delivery processes, and team development across the consultancy.
Hands-On Support: When needed, dive into technical detail whether guiding architectural decisions, supporting debugging, or resolving critical issues.
What We’re Looking For

Extensive Experience: Proven background in data engineering, software development, or systems integration preferably within AI, analytics, or enterprise platforms like Palantir Foundry.
Leadership Track Record: Demonstrable experience leading engineering or delivery teams, ideally within a consultancy, systems integrator, or complex client-facing environment.
Technical Depth: Strong grasp of modern data architecture, cloud platforms, and programming languages such as Python, Java, or similar.
Strategic Thinker: Able to balance hands-on involvement with big-picture planning and stakeholder management.
Excellent Communicator: Skilled in engaging with both senior technical and non-technical stakeholders, providing clear, confident guidance.
Delivery Oriented: Focused on outcomes, capable of navigating ambiguity and delivering under pressure.
Agile & Adaptable: Comfortable working across sectors and with diverse clients, adjusting approaches as needed.
Travel Readiness: Open to occasional travel (up to 25%) depending on project requirements.
